KEY FEATURES
This product adopts advanced BIA (bioelectrical impedance Analysis) technology to measure body fat,
hydration, muscle and bone percentage by sending a safe low-tension electric current through the body
and the difference of electrical conductive property of body fat from other tissues is analyzed and
processed by the CPU to get the body component percentage, then the results are displayed on the LCD
screen to offer you reference.
Also display BMI parameter, more reference data.
Use high precision sensor to obtain more exact weight.
Use high quality tempered glass and elegant support feet for sleek modern style.
Personal data can be stored in the memory of the unit for up to 10 people. It is very convenient to use.
Capacity: 2kg-150kg
Division: 0.1kg
Auto zero & Auto off
Low battery and over load indication
Free switch within three different units: kg/lb/st:lb
Powered by 1X3V lithium cell and one free lithium battery CR2032 is packed in the box.

Because of differences in geographic areas and locations, the body fat percentage standards and percentage
standards can vary .This sheet is for reference only.
Please remember your personal key. You do not need to program personal key the next time you use scale. You
can use the personal key you have already stored.
CAUTION
1. Personals with pacemakers should not use this product.
2. Personals with metal implants will be unable to obtain accurate readings.
3. To ensure accuracy, we suggest using scale at the same time every night (19:00-21:00).
4. “Lo” on scale display indicate that the battery is out of power. You should install a new one.
5. The “EEEE” on scale display indicates overload scale “Err2” display indicates fat percentage
measurement error.
6. If body fat percentage is less than 5%, indicator displays “Err2” If more than 50% indicator displays
“Err2” If impedance measuring makes an error, indicator will display “Err2”.

NOTE
1. You should place scale on clear, flat surface before use.
2. Do not place scale on wet, severely hot or extremely cold surfaces.
3. Do not jump or stomp on scale. Do not attempt to disassemble the scale.
4. To avoid falling off scale, do not stand on the scale to avoid glass and electrode wear out.
5. Do not ware shoes when standing on the scale to avoid glass and electrode wear out.
6. Never submerge the unit in water. Use alcohol to clean the electrodes and glass cleaner to keep them
shiny, applied to a cloth first; avoid soaps.
7. For home use only. Not for professional use. Body fat percentage and hydration percentage is reference
only. You should consult a doctor when you undertake any diet or exercise program.
8. Check battery if scale malfunction. If necessary, install a new battery. For other problems, please
contact your local franchiser or contact our company for repair.
